However, nowadays the lack of interoperability between different transport modes and information systems impede the capacity to perform a door-to-door journey as a seamless and hassle-free multimodal journey. Travellers have to deal with different tools, procedures and interfaces to book a multimodal journey across the Europe, and even in a same country.
The MaaSive project was launched in November 2018 as a part of Shift2Rail’s Innovation Programme 4 (IP4) with the objective of not only enhancing and providing extra functionalities to the existing IP4 ecosystem (developed by the previous IP4 projects) enabling door-to-door seamless multimodal travelling. This has been specifically demonstrated in the areas of Travel Shopping where the challenge of pan-European journey planning using one fully integrated network with all transport modes was tackled by simplifying the integrated network to reduce the complexity and enabling the calculation of travel solution approximations leading to a 2-Step Journey Planning approach.
The project work on a digital Travel Companion focused on enabling location-based experience using Hololens and use of mixed-reality solutions to improve passengers’ experience was demonstrated by showcasing the ease in which mixed reality composer can be used by any MaaS operator and/or TSP.
The Demand Responsive Transport mode integration with public transport was also developed during the MaaSive duration.
Finally, the MaaSive project emphasised the compatibility of IP4 ecosystem with the Mobility as a Service (MaaS) approach, which has been illustrated by the creation and application of Mobility Packages. These have demonstrated how multimodal trips can be promoted easily by the TSPs and/or MaaS operators.

The MaaSive project results have been successfully presented to the industry and scientific audiences throughout the project duration (including during the Shift2Rail Innovation Days event, and project final showcase event). This was done in close collaboration with the Open Call project Shift2MaaS dedicated to supporting the use of S2R IP technologies via the preparation and execution of pilots with several Travel Services Providers in Europe, as well as COHESIVE and CONNECTVE projects. The MaaSive results in the area of Travel Shopping, Booking and Ticketing, Trip Tracking and digital Travel Companion will be developed further within the final IP4 Call For Members project - ExtenSive.
The MaaSive Project approach takes into account existing S2R acquis (both in engineering and legal aspects) and enlarges its scope through further complementary developments within the most crucial (for combined public and private transport) aspects, i.e.: Travel Shopping, Booking & Ticketing, Trip Tracker, Travel Companion and Business Rules. Foreseen in the project activities are expected to benefit the one unified seamless urban transport environment by means of enhancement of existing and filling in the missing links between different transport modes.
The level and the coverage of the services provided to the travellers will is increased with more modes, extensive set of services in the different TDs, up to date technologies to interact with the user: travelling will become more easy, efficient and pleasant and therefore should indirectly increase the number of travellers.
Within dualistic approach both the travellers (passengers) and transport operating companies benefit from the way different ITS technologies are implemented. In this particular case MaaSive Project shows its potential value by addressing not only rail but also other modes of transport, offering solutions for holistic transportation services.
